Better Emergency Response and Evacuation Support
In emergencies such as fire alarms or medical situations, fast movement is essential. School sliding safety doors are designed to open smoothly and quickly, allowing people to exit without delay. Unlike traditional doors that may swing and block pathways, sliding doors move neatly along tracks and keep escape routes clear. This helps reduce panic and confusion during urgent situations. Emergency teams also benefit from easier access when needed. By improving evacuation flow, these doors play an important role in protecting lives and ensuring that schools respond effectively in critical moments.
Reduced Risk of Accidents in Busy School Areas
School corridors, entrances, and cafeterias often become crowded during breaks and dismissal times. In such busy environments, traditional doors can sometimes cause accidents when opened suddenly. School sliding safety doors help reduce this risk because they do not swing outward into walking paths. This makes movement smoother and safer for students of all ages. Younger children, in particular, benefit from the reduced chance of getting hit or trapped by a swinging door. By minimizing physical hazards, these doors contribute to a more secure and comfortable school experience for everyone.
